Hi! Yesterday happened the strangest thing. I have played The Witcher 3 for more than 150 hours and never had this problem before. Most of the time I have played on my TV, and the TV speakers sound. Yesterday I connected the HDMI cable from the TV to the PC to play as usual, and when I started the game I realized I had my PC speakers as sound output (usually when I connected the TV the output device would switch automatically). So I exit, change the sound device from the PC speakers to the TV speakers on Windows, start the game again and it froze on a black screen after starting.
I could not alt-tab, nor alt-F4. I could ctrl-alt-del, but if I opened the task manager, nothing would happen. I restarted the computer several times, turned the TV off and on, but same thing kept happening. Then I tried starting the game without the TV connected, with my PC monitor, and it worked fine, sound included. But if I connected it to the TV, it would again crash. Then I tried starting the game from the TV but with my PC speakers selected, and the game run completely normal... wtf?
Does anybody know what the hell happened all of a sudden? And can I fix it? I wouldn't want to have to keep playing having the sound coming out of my PC speakers on the side of the room...
